excel表格小数递增怎么做?如何实现下拉递增?
作者:佚名|分类:EXCEL|浏览:72|发布时间:2025-03-21 02:04:55
Excel表格小数递增怎么做?如何实现下拉递增?
在Excel中,实现小数递增和下拉递增是日常工作中常见的需求。以下将详细介绍如何通过Excel的功能来实现这两个功能。
一、小数递增的实现方法
小数递增通常指的是在单元格中自动填充递增的小数。以下是一个简单的方法来实现小数递增:
1. 选择起始值:首先,在Excel表格中选中一个单元格,输入你想要作为起始的小数值。
2. 填充递增:选中该单元格,将鼠标移至单元格右下角,当鼠标变成黑色十字时,按住鼠标左键向下拖动,直到你想要填充递增的单元格数量。
3. 设置递增步长:在拖动填充时,Excel会根据相邻单元格的值自动递增。如果你需要设置特定的递增步长,可以在拖动填充时按住`Ctrl`键,然后在拖动过程中输入你想要的步长。
4. 使用公式:如果你需要更复杂的递增逻辑,可以使用公式来实现。例如,使用`=A1+0.1`这样的公式,在A1单元格中输入起始值,然后在A2单元格中输入这个公式,并将A2单元格向下填充,即可实现每次递增0.1。
二、下拉递增的实现方法
下拉递增通常指的是在Excel下拉列表中选择一个值后,下一个下拉列表中的值自动递增。以下是如何实现下拉递增的步骤:
1. 创建下拉列表:首先,在Excel表格中选中一个单元格区域,这个区域将用来创建下拉列表。
2. 输入数据:在选中的单元格区域中输入你想要作为下拉列表选项的数据。
3. 设置数据验证:选中这个单元格区域,然后点击“数据”选项卡,选择“数据验证”。
4. 配置数据验证:在“设置”选项卡中,将“允许”设置为“序列”,然后在“来源”框中输入你想要的数据序列,例如“1,2,3,4,5”。
5. 实现递增:如果你想要在选中一个值后,下一个下拉列表中的值自动递增,可以在第二个下拉列表的“来源”框中输入一个公式,例如`=IF(A1="1", "2", IF(A1="2", "3", IF(A1="3", "4", IF(A1="4", "5", ""))))`。这样,当你在第一个下拉列表中选择一个值时,第二个下拉列表会根据第一个下拉列表的值自动递增。
三、相关问答
1. 如何在Excel中实现小数递增,但每次递增的步长不是固定的?
答:你可以使用公式结合Excel的`ROUND`函数来实现非固定步长的小数递增。例如,如果你想要每次递增0.05,可以在起始单元格中使用公式`=A1+ROUND(0.05,2)`,然后在下一个单元格中引用这个公式,并向下填充。
2. 如何在Excel中实现下拉递增,但递增的值不是连续的数字?
答:你可以使用Excel的`IF`和`OR`函数结合逻辑判断来实现非连续值的下拉递增。例如,如果你想要根据第一个下拉列表的值来决定第二个下拉列表的值,可以在第二个下拉列表的“来源”框中输入一个复杂的公式,如`=IF(OR(A1="选项1", A1="选项2"), "选项3", IF(A1="选项3", "选项4", IF(A1="选项4", "选项5", "")))`。
3. 如何在Excel中实现小数递增,但起始值是小数?
答:起始值是小数时,你可以直接在单元格中输入小数值,然后使用上述方法进行递增填充。Excel会自动处理小数点的位置。
通过以上方法,你可以在Excel中轻松实现小数递增和下拉递增的功能,提高工作效率。